namespace content {
class GeneratedCodeCache;
// One instance exists per disk-backed (non in-memory) storage contexts. This
// owns the instance of `GeneratedCodeCache` that is used to store the data
// generated by the renderer (for ex: code caches for script resources). This
// initializes and closes the code cache on the code cache thread. The
// instance of this class (`this`) itself is constructed on the UI thread.
class CONTENT_EXPORT GeneratedCodeCacheContext
: public base::RefCountedThreadSafe<GeneratedCodeCacheContext> {
public:
REQUIRE_ADOPTION_FOR_REFCOUNTED_TYPE();
// Runs a task on the code cache thread, or immediately if already on the code
// cache thread.
static void RunOrPostTask(scoped_refptr<GeneratedCodeCacheContext> context,
const base::Location& location,
base::OnceClosure task);
// Gets the task runner for the code cache thread.
static scoped_refptr<base::SequencedTaskRunner> GetTaskRunner(
scoped_refptr<GeneratedCodeCacheContext> context);
GeneratedCodeCacheContext();
GeneratedCodeCacheContext(const GeneratedCodeCacheContext&) = delete;
GeneratedCodeCacheContext& operator=(const GeneratedCodeCacheContext&) =
delete;
// Initialize is called on the UI thread when the StoragePartition is
// being setup.
void Initialize(const base::FilePath& path, int max_bytes);
void Shutdown();
// Shuts down the context and runs `callback` on the caller's sequence once
// all background tasks have completed.
void ShutdownForTesting(base::OnceClosure callback);
// Call on the code cache thread to get the code cache instances.
GeneratedCodeCache* generated_js_code_cache() const;
GeneratedCodeCache* generated_wasm_code_cache() const;
GeneratedCodeCache* generated_webui_js_code_cache() const;
// Use to get rid of code cached in the PersistentCache collection both in
// memory and persisted.
void ClearAndDeletePersistentCacheCollection();
#if !BUILDFLAG(IS_FUCHSIA)
// Returns a pending backend for an independent read-only connection to the
// `context_key` cache, or nothing if it is not functional or the handles
// cannot be exported. The returned value grants read access to all data
// stored in the cache corresponding to `context_key`. Take care to only pass
// it to the renderer for which it is intended; see
// CodeCacheWithPersistentCacheHost::GetCacheId for more on this topic.
std::optional<persistent_cache::PendingBackend> ShareReadOnlyConnection(
const std::string& context_key);
// Inserts `content` and `metadata` for `cache_key` in the cache identified by
// `context_key`.
void InsertIntoPersistentCacheCollection(
const std::string& context_key,
base::span<const uint8_t> cache_key,
base::span<const uint8_t> content,
persistent_cache::EntryMetadata metadata);
// A simple container for the metadata associated with an entry in the cache
// and the content that was cached. (The content is separate from the metadata
// so that consumers of PersistentCache can control allocation of the memory
// and the data type holding it.)
struct MetadataAndContent {
persistent_cache::EntryMetadata metadata;
mojo_base::BigBuffer content;
};
// Returns the entry for `cache_key` in the cache identified by `context_key`,
// or no value in case of a cache miss or retrieval error.
std::optional<MetadataAndContent> FindInPersistentCacheCollection(
const std::string& context_key,
base::span<const uint8_t> cache_key);
#endif // !BUILDFLAG(IS_FUCHSIA)
private:
friend class base::RefCountedThreadSafe<GeneratedCodeCacheContext>;
~GeneratedCodeCacheContext();
void InitializeOnThread(const base::FilePath& path, int max_bytes);
void ShutdownOnThread(
DedicatedTaskRunnerForResource task_runner_for_resource);
void ShutdownOnThreadForTesting(
base::OnceClosure callback,
DedicatedTaskRunnerForResource task_runner_for_resource);
// Created, used and deleted on the code cache thread. Disabled when
// PersistentCacheForCodeCache is enabled.
std::unique_ptr<GeneratedCodeCache> generated_js_code_cache_
GUARDED_BY_CONTEXT(sequence_checker_);
std::unique_ptr<GeneratedCodeCache> generated_wasm_code_cache_
GUARDED_BY_CONTEXT(sequence_checker_);
std::unique_ptr<GeneratedCodeCache> generated_webui_js_code_cache_
GUARDED_BY_CONTEXT(sequence_checker_);
#if !BUILDFLAG(IS_FUCHSIA)
// Created and used when either PersistentCacheForCodeCache or
// InlineScriptCache is enabled.
// When the former is enabled, this replaces all of `generated_*_code_cache_`
// above and stores the code following the same isolation principles but using
// two keys instead of one. The first key is used to get a `PersistentCache`
// associated with an isolation context from the collection. This ensures that
// each isolation context uses a separate database file. The second key is the
// prefixed resource URL of a serialized script.
// When the latter is enabled, this stores source-keyed code cache entries
// with the two-keys keying. The second key is the source hash digest (SHA256)
// of a serialized script.
// Note that those two features can be enabled at the same time and share the
// same collection in that case.
std::unique_ptr<persistent_cache::PersistentCacheCollection>
persistent_cache_collection_ GUARDED_BY_CONTEXT(sequence_checker_);
#endif // !BUILDFLAG(IS_FUCHSIA)
// A handle that keeps a TaskRunner associated with this context's path alive
// for as long as this instance operates on files within that path.
DedicatedTaskRunnerForResource task_runner_for_resource_;
scoped_refptr<base::SequencedTaskRunner> task_runner_;
SEQUENCE_CHECKER(sequence_checker_);
};
